What is ADHD?
Before diving into private assessments, it’s crucial to understand what ADHD is. Defined by pat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, ADHD can considerably affect different elements of life consisting of education, work, and interpersonal relationships. Signs might provide in a different way in kids and adults, with some overlapping functions.

Clients can pick visits that fit their schedules, decreasing stress.What to Expect from a Private ADHD Assessment
Comprehending the format of a private ADHD assessment can assist clients adequately get ready for the experience. Normally, the procedure is thorough and must consist of several elements.
Assessment Components
- Preliminary Consultation
- A scientific interview discussing medical history, family background, and symptoms.
- Clinical Interview
- In-depth discussions– typically with relative or instructors– to collect varied viewpoints on behavior.
- Standardized Rating Scales
- Use of validated tools to quantify the intensity and frequency of ADHD symptoms, such as the Conners Rating Scale.
- Cognitive Testing
- Assessment of numerous cognitive functions consisting of memory, attention span, and executive operating through standardized tests.
- Behavioral Observations
- Observations in real-life settings (if relevant) to confirm symptoms are constant across environments.
- Final Diagnosis and Recommendations
- After assessment, specialists will provide a diagnosis (if relevant) and discuss treatment options and methods.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How long does an ADHD assessment take?
- The assessment procedure can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a number of weeks, depending upon the intricacy and the info required.
2. Will my insurance cover the cost of a private assessment?
- Protection differs by provider. It is suggested to contact your insurance company to discuss prospective protection and any out-of-pocket costs you might incur.
3. Are ADHD assessments ideal for both children and adults?
- Yes, private ADHD assessments are developed for both children and adults, though the assessment might differ somewhat based upon age.
4. What occurs if I get a diagnosis?
- If detected with ADHD, the expert will discuss various treatment options, consisting of treatment, medication, and lifestyle modifications to much better handle symptoms.
